li#wp-admin-bar-elementor_edit_page {display: none;}

.page-template-homepage .bwp-header.header-v5 .wpbingoLogo img {
	max-height: 80px;
}

.postid-17023 div#bwp-main.bwp-main .container {
    width: 1200px !important;
}

.rdar-container .rdar-element img {
  height: auto !important;
  object-fit: inherit !important;
}

/*
@media (min-width: 1200px){
.col-xl-6 {
    flex: 0 0 100%;
    max-width: 100%;
  }}
.bwp-header .header-search-form {
    flex: none;
    float: right;
}

.page-template-homepage .bwp-header.header-v5 .wpbingoLogo img {
    height: 80px;

}

.bwp-header.header-v5 .wpbingoLogo {

    height: 80px;
}

.page-template-homepage .container {
    max-width: 1440px;
    height: 80px;
}

.bwp-header .wpbingoLogo img {
    max-height: inherit;

}
.page-template-homepage .bwp-header.header-v5 .wpbingoLogo img {
     max-height: inherit; 
}*/

.wpbingoLogo img {
  max-height: 120px !important;
  width: auto;
}

#bwp-footer.bwp-footer.footer-3 {background:#000;background-image: url(https://s3spa.com/wp-content/themes/davici/footer-map.png) !important;background-repeat: no-repeat;background-position: center;}

@media (min-width: 992px){
  .bwp-navigation {min-width: 550px;}
  .bwp-header .content-header {max-width: 950px;}
  .bwp-header .header-menu {margin-left: 0px;}
  /*.bwp-header .header-right {max-width: 450px;}
  .bwp-header .header-menu {margin-left: 0px;}
  .bwp-header .header-page-link {width: 400px;}*/
}

.bwp-header .header-page-link .phone i {color: #D56300;}
.bwp-header .header-page-link .phone {border: 2px solid #6c757d;}

.bwp-header .header-page-link > * {margin-left: 10px;}

.page-title.bwp-title {  background-image: url(https://s3spa.com/wp-content/uploads/2024/04/S3Spa-Luxury-Pedicure-Chairs-Salon-Equipment-and-Furniture-Online-Store-bg.jpg) !important;}

.elementor-element .elementor-swiper, .elementor-lightbox .elementor-swiper {
  overflow-x: hidden;
}

  @media (min-width: 1440px){
.container {
  max-width: 1440px !important;
    }}

  @media (min-width: 1440px){
.page-id-9361 .elementor-page #bwp-main > .container, .elementor-page #main-content > .container {
 max-width: 100% !important;
    }}

.bwp-header .header-page-link .phone i {
  color: #A18700;
}

div.swatch.swatch-shape-circle.swatch-type-image.swatch-image.swatch-air-vent-100.swatch-ratio-disabled {height: 50px !important;}

div.swatch.swatch-shape-circle.swatch-type-image.swatch-image.swatch-autofill-100.swatch-ratio-disabled {height: 50px !important;}

div.swatch.swatch-shape-circle.swatch-type-image.swatch-image.swatch-drain-pump-179.swatch-ratio-disabled {height: 50px !important;}

div.swatch.swatch-shape-circle.swatch-type-image.swatch-image.swatch-none.swatch-ratio-disabled {height: 50px !important;}

div.swatch.swatch-shape-circle.swatch-type-image.swatch-image.swatch-sub-remote-55.swatch-ratio-disabled {height: 50px !important;}

.woosw-btn.darkmysite_style_button.darkmysite_processed.darkmysite_style_secondary_bg.darkmysite_style_all .quickview-container .bwp-single-info .woosw-btn::before, .single-product .bwp-single-info .woosw-btn::before {color: #ccc;border: 1px solid #ccc;}

.woocommerce-tabs #reviews #comments ol.commentlist li .comment-text .meta .woocommerce-review__published-date {display:none;}

.woosw-btn.darkmysite_style_button.darkmysite_processed.darkmysite_style_secondary_bg.darkmysite_style_all .quickview-container .bwp-single-info .woosc-btn::before, .single-product .bwp-single-info .woosc-btn::before {color: #ccc;border: 1px solid #ccc;}

.comment-form-cookies-consent {
    width: 61%;
}
form#searchform.search-from {display:none;}
article#post-17219 time.entry-date.published {display: inherit;}
article#post-17219 time.updated {display: none;}

@media (max-width: 778px){
div.elementor-element.elementor-element-deacd03.elementor-widget.elementor-widget-slider_revolution, section.elementor-section.elementor-top-section.elementor-element.elementor-element-0ece1b2.elementor-section-boxed.elementor-section-height-default.elementor-section-height-default, section.elementor-section.elementor-top-section.elementor-element.elementor-element-c1dd67d.elementor-section-full_width.elementor-section-height-default.elementor-section-height-default {
    display:none !important;
  }
.slick-slide img {
    width: 500px;
}
  /*.elementor-9361 .elementor-element.elementor-element-c1d041d, .elementor-9361 .elementor-element.elementor-element-ec19027 {margin-bottom: 70px;}*/
  
  .bwp-widget-banner.default .bwp-image img {
    width: 100%;
    margin-bottom: 70px;
}
  /*.bwp-widget-banner.layout-1 .bwp-image img {
    margin-bottom: 70px;
}*/

}

@media only screen and (min-device-width: 767px) and (max-device-width: 1024px) and (orientation:landscape) {
      /* For landscape layouts only */
  .elementor-column.elementor-col-50, .elementor-column[data-col="50"] {
    width: 100%;margin-bottom: -100px;
}
  .elementor-column.elementor-col-50.elementor-top-column.elementor-element.elementor-element-fee8e91 {display:none;}
  .slick-slide img {
    width: 500px;
}
    }

@media only screen and (min-device-width: 550px) and (max-device-width: 767px) {
.slick-slide img {
    width: 767px;
}
}
@media (max-width: 1024px){
.elementor-column.elementor-col-50.elementor-top-column.elementor-element.elementor-element-dd658af {display:none;}}

@media (max-width: 501px){

.swiper-backface-hidden .swiper-slide {height: 250px !important; }}

.entry-thumb.single-thumb div.post-date {display:none !important;}
